    Intended Use
    Smart Scope® CX is intended for gynecological examination. It provides a portable means of magnified visualization of the tissues of the vagina, cervix, and external genitalia to aid in diagnosing abnormalities and selecting areas for biopsy. The Net4Medix® application is intended to provide documentation of the field of view of the scope. The Smart Scope® CX camera probe is intended to be inserted into the a speculum by trained medical personnel in hospitals, clinics, and private offices, and is not intended for home use.
    Device Description
    Smart Scope® CX is a handheld, reusable transvaginal digital examination camera designed for use in a hospital or clinical setting. It is intended for close examination and magnified visualization of the external genitalia, vagina, and cervix. The Smart Scope® CX camera probe is equipped with an integrated green and white LED light, which serves to illuminate the object under observation. Additionally, it features a 10X magnification camera, facilitating the capture of color images. Users can switch between the white and green light illumination and zoom in or out to capture images at different working distances by pressing respective buttons in the smart scope probe. By establishing a USB connection between the Smart Scope and a tablet, users can access live images and capture necessary stills using the Net4Medix® application, installed on the tablet. These captured images are then stored directly on the tablet. The Net4Medix® software further enables the creation and management of patient records, visit histories, and seamless integration with the Smart Scope® CX for functions such as image streaming, capture, storage, and assignment to the respective patient records. The Smart Scope® CX is designed and intended to be used only with speculum and it is not intended to come into direct contact with the body. Smart Scope® CX is not a substitute for histopathology and is not a diagnostic test.
